SUBSTRUCTURAL ALTERATION OF STAINLESS STEEL DURING CONSTANT STRAIN FATIGUE
|
Abstract:
The alteration of substructure of an austenitic stainless steel hasbeen investigated during constant strain fatigue. No plateau stage on the cyclicstress-strain curve was observed for the stainless steel in contrast with a mono-crystalline pure copper specimen. This may be related to its low stacking fault en-ergy. During strain fatigue under various amplitudes the substructure of dislocationin austenite alterates correspondingly. It revealed to be associated with the appear-ance change of the cyclic stress-strain curve.
